A Florida Congressional candidate tweeted that Beyoncé is not African American.

“She is faking this for exposure.” KW Miller wrote, “Her real name is Ann Marie Lastrassi. She is Italian. This is all part of the Soros Deep State agenda for the Black Lives Matter movement.”

Miller finished his bizarre claim by stating, “BEYONCÉ YOU ARE ON NOTICE!”

The post instantly went viral and fans of the singer suggested that the man seek help.

Miller is running to represent the 18th Congressional District in Florida. The area is currently represented by Republican Brian Mast.

Miller did not end his rant there. He also alleged that the 24-time Grammy winner’s song, “Formation,” contains Satanic messaging.

“The song clearly admitted that she was demonic and that she worshipped in the Satanist churches located in Alabama & Louisiana,” he continued. “She keeps Satanist symbols in her bag.” Miller was referring to the line, “I got hot sauce in my bag, swag…”
